Klx250sf starting with choke on but dying when given throttle or taking choke off
Where do you have the idle (pilot) mixture screw set to? It should be around 2 1/2 turns out. Adjusting the idle speed screw in opens the throttle plate a bit and reduces the affect of the idle mixture circuit. In that case, the carb is trying to operate on the main jet and needle circuit. The fuel from the idle circuit enters the air stream through a few tiny holes in the throttle bore right at the bottom of the closed throttle plate. My guess is that you still have a restriction in the idle circuit....pilot jet, idle mixture screw, or the fuel passages.
